About Joliet Living & Rehab Center

Nursing home overview and details

Joliet Living & Rehab Center is a for-profit nursing home in Joliet, IL, serving Will County and the surrounding community. The facility has 120 certified beds with an average daily census of 92.2 residents.

Joliet Living & Rehab Center has been Medicare and Medicaid certified since 1975, bringing 51 years of experience in long-term care.

CMS has assigned this facility a 2-star quality rating. Families are encouraged to review the detailed quality and safety measures below. Staffing

Nurse staffing hours and turnover

Joliet Living & Rehab Center provides 2.20 total nursing hours per resident per day, of which 0.44 hours are from registered nurses. The facility reports a nurse turnover rate of 22.4%, which is lower than many facilities, suggesting staff stability. RN-specific turnover is 23.1%. Weekend staffing averages 1.95 hours per resident per day.

Safety & Compliance

Regulatory record and safety data

Joliet Living & Rehab Center has been flagged for abuse-related concerns by CMS. Families should discuss these findings with the facility administration to understand what corrective actions have been taken and what improvements have been implemented.
